Find the area between the graph of y=x^2-2 and the x-axis, between x=0 and x=5. I took the integral and got 31.667.. not sure if thats right

OpenStudy (dumbcow):

\[\int\limits_0^5 x^2 - 2 = \frac{x^3}{3} - 2x \rightarrow \frac{5^3}{3} - 10\]

OpenStudy (dumbcow):

you are correct
